ROCK (Rho-associated, coiled-coil containing protein kinase) has two isoforms, ROCK1 and ROCK2 that share 65% sequence similarity. ROCK has three domains that include the N-terminal catalytic domain (CAT), a middle coiled-coil domain that mediates homodimerization, and Rho-binding (RB) and pleckstrin homology (PH) domains (RB/PH domain) at the C-terminus. The RB/PH domain acts as an autoinhibitory domain and suppresses the kinase activity of CAT. ROCK1 (Rho-associated, coiled-coil containing protein kinase 1) gene encodes a 160kDa serine/threonine kinase that specifically binds to GTP-bound Rho. It is a platelet protein with 1354 amino acids. It has a Ser/Thr kinase domain in its N-terminus, followed by a 600 amino acid long coiled-coil structure. The C-terminal region contains a cysteine-rich zinc finger-like motif and a pleckstrin homology region.

Biochem Physiol Actions: ROCK1 (Rho-associated, coiled-coil containing protein kinase 1), an effector of the small GTPase Rho, functions along with the small GTPase Rho in phosphorylating LIM-kinase 1, which in turn phosphorylates cofilin, an actin-depolymerizing factor, thereby regulating actin cytoskeletal reorganization. It is capable of inducing Ca2+-independent contraction of smooth muscle. Activation of ROCK1 by cleavage with caspase-3 stimulates the formation of membrane bleb formation in apoptotic cells. It phosphorylates and regulates zipper-interacting protein kinase (ZIPK) that mediates Ca2+-independent phosphorylation of both smooth muscle and non-muscle myosin.
